The tour begins with a visit to the 340-metre-long suspension bridge over Lake Thun, where you’ll experience a 182-metre-high crossing offering sweeping views of the surrounding mountains and water. This iconic structure provides perfect photo opportunities and a sense of awe at the engineering marvel amidst natural beauty. The admission fee is included, and the stop lasts about 30 minutes, giving plenty of time to enjoy the scenery and snap photos.

Next, the tour stops at the St. Beatus-Hohlen, where a free coffee break awaits in the garden of this famous cave complex. Visitors can enjoy a relaxing 30-minute pause amid lush greenery, with the opportunity to explore the nearby caves if desired. The admission to the caves is included, making this a perfect spot for a quick cultural and natural interlude.
A scenic drive follows along Lake Brienz to Brunngasse, recognized as one of the most beautiful streets worldwide by Architectural Digest. Here, travelers can admire colorful houses and charming architecture during a 20-minute visit. This street’s beauty makes it an ideal place for photos and soaking in the local atmosphere, with no additional admission fees required.
The culinary highlight happens at CHALET CHIARA in Hofstetten bei Brienz, where a traditional Swiss raclette lunch is included in the tour. The meal features melted cheese served with an assortment of sides, accompanied by table water. Other drinks are available for purchase if desired. The lunch lasts about an hour, offering a hearty break and a taste of authentic Swiss cuisine in a cozy setting.
After lunch, the tour proceeds to Giessbach Falls, where waters cascade down 14 steps into Lake Brienz. This stunning natural spectacle lasts about an hour, giving ample opportunity for photographs and soaking in the power of moving water amid lush surroundings. The admission fee to the falls is included, ensuring an up-close view of this impressive waterfall.
